JOB DESCRIPTION SUMMARYThe Business Development Liaison is responsible for developing new referral sources, maintaining those relationships and consistently promoting CHH throughout the healthcare community. The qualified candidate must grow and maintain a pipeline of patient referral sources to consistently increase the agency's overall patient census.
